I think some people need a reality check...
This is a $25,000 car. In today's marketplace, that's 'bargain basement'. Too many people are complaining about poor quality stereo, no steering wheel controls, poor visibility, and other bullshit 'issues'. I think many of them would be better off selling their FR-S/BRZ and buying something that has better ergonomics and accouterments, like maybe a mini-van?
Seriously, many of you don't realize what a great package deal this vehicle is. I've owned MANY cars and unless something major pops up repeatedly on cars across the world like engine fires, crankshafts cracking in half, wheels falling off, etc., it's NOT a big deal at this price point. Rattles in the dashboard, speaker covers that don't stay attached, and other trivial stuff is just going to piss off the dealerships when people keep bugging them about it and take away their time and resources to deal with real problems. This car is NOT perfect. Little flaws like these should be taken care of by the owners. If you want a top quality vehicle, spend the money and buy a $50,000+ priced car. This car was a vision and concessions were made to achieve the vision and still make it affordable. Yes, Toyota/Subaru probably pulled existing stuff off the shelf and fitted it to the car. Yes, they probably scrimped a little on the selection of materials to use. That's called cost-cutting measures. If they would have spent more on development, the car would have been priced significantly higher. Legitimate problems should be addressed (taillight moisture, idling issues) but this 'the sky is falling' mentality because the driver can hear the differential whine at 85 mph really needs to be reeled in. Just my opinion. |
